Transaction 28de466e66a916d7de8b003fd0523afc83c9186cf9452391a527aeab2c4d1fc6
1 Input
1 Output
-
28de466e66a916d7de8b003fd0523afc83c9186cf9452391a527aeab2c4d1fc6:0
- value
- 583000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aabb4338b2405a8063f97894ae7aca843ef82b69 OP_EQUAL
- address
- 3HFm8PRKA4RCjJvAMjWyBw5hH3gDiASScD